




已阅读5页,还剩57页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
第9章创建了一个实用的Access数据库、一个公司的客户管理系统采购、销售和存储管理系统、一个9.1公司的客户管理系统和一个9.1.1“公司的客户管理系统”数据表。作为一个销售公司,或者对于一个工厂的销售部门来说,建立一个公司的客户管理系统可以有效地避免由于销售人员个人工作的变化而造成的公司客户流失,并且还可以方便我们统计每个销售人员的销售业绩和地区之间的销售差异。根据公司的情况,建立公司的客户管理系统共需要5张表,如下页图所示。1。创建基本表格,创建空白的“公司客户信息管理系统”数据库后,切换到“创建”标签页,点击“表格设计”按钮,打开“表格设计器”窗口。1,2.在表设计器窗口中,根据本书表9-1的要求输入相应的字段名,根据需要在数据类型栏中设置相应的“数据类型”,然后将“客户号”设置为“主键”,不要先设置这些“通用”属性,下面将分别设置。在“表设计器”窗口中,选择“公司名称”字段,并在下面的“常规”选项卡中将格式设置为:公司名称:“查询功能”区域增加“查询”按钮;添加”!清除所有客户信息(注意) 、保存和修改和删除此记录命令按钮,11、通过以上操作步骤,我们已经完成了客户信息管理表单的创建,双击打开它,效果如图所示,9.1.4创建客户报表,右键选择报表表头/表尾命令,2、打开客户管理系统数据库,进入报表设计视图工作区,1、在“页脚”部分创建另一个文本框,删除其相应的标签,在文本框中输入“=页页”,4,并在“报告标题”部分添加一个文本框。在标签框中输入不同地区的客户,字体设置为12粗体斜体,在文本框中输入=NOW(),3、双击报表属性按钮打开报表属性窗口,5、切换到“数据”标签页。点击记录来源组合框的下拉按钮,选择客户信息表项,6、切换到设计标签页,点击分组和排序按钮,打开排序和分组窗口,7、点击“添加排序”按钮,在打开的字段列表中选择“区域”字段,默认排序顺序为升序,分组形式设置为“页眉节”和“页脚节”,8,单击“字段列表”中的“区域”项目,将其拖到“区域标题”部分第一行的网格中,并将其标签和文本框的字体设置为12粗体。9、在两行之间添加一个标签,将其标题改为公司名称,重复同样的操作在同一行上添加另外两个标签:联系人和联系人电话,12、画两行,颜色设为深灰色1 颜色,边框宽度为3点,10、在“区域页脚”部分绘制一个文本框,将其标签改为“客户编号”,在文本框中输入“=计数(公司名称)”和“14”,将字段列表中的“公司名称”拖到“主体”部分的第一行,并删除其相应的标签。重复相同的操作,将“联系人”和“联系电话”项目添加到“主体”部分。13.点击关闭按钮,弹出“提示”保存对话框,点击“是”按钮。将弹出“另存为”对话框,输入“不同地区的客户”。单击“确定”按钮完成报告创建。15岁,双击“不同地区的客户”项目,打开我们刚刚创建的报告。16.在该报表中,“报表表头”显示报表名称和当前时间,“地区表头”和“主体”依次显示客户记录。9.1.5使用宏创建主窗体,打开“客户管理系统”数据库,切换到“创建”选项卡,然后单击“宏”按钮。1.点击“操作”栏第一行的下拉按钮,选择“OpenQuery”项,然后在其操作参数区的“查询名称”中选择“各公司年度供货订单”项。3.切换到“设计”标签页,点击宏名称按钮,增加“宏名称”栏,点击“宏名称”栏的第一行,输入“查询每个客户的年度供货订单”。2.在第二行的“宏名称”栏中,输入“查询供应量最高的五个供应订单”,在“操作”栏中选择“OpenQuery”项,在操作参数区的“查询名称”中选择“供应量最高的五个供应订单”项。4,在“宏名称”栏的第四行输入“打印每个地区的客户报告”,并在相应的“操作”栏中选择“OpenReport”项。然后,在其操作参数区的报表名称中,选择项目不同地区的客户,6,点击宏名称列的第三行,进入打开客户信息管理表单。点击操作栏第三行的下拉按钮,选择 OpenForm 项,然后在其操作参数区的表单名称中选择客户信息管理项,5、重复同样的操作,在“宏名”栏的第五行输入“关闭当前表单”项,在“操作”栏中选择“关闭”项,其操作参数区都保持系统默认,8,7,在“宏名”栏的第六行输入“关闭当前数据库”项,在其对应的“操作”栏中选择“关闭”项,其操作参数区都保持系统默认。在第七行的“操作”列中选择“退出”项目。并另存为“宏组”宏,在“属性”窗口中,单击“事件”选项卡,然后单击“单击”下拉框中的下拉按钮,选择项目“宏组”。查询每个客户的年度供货清单,11,打开表单的设计视图,添加一个命令按钮控件,将其标题改为查看:每个客户的年度供货清单,10,重复同样的操作,再添加五个命令按钮。并为它们的点击事件选择相应的宏,9,双击运行“主窗体”,点击“打印报表:各地区客户”按钮,执行效果如下图所示,12、9.1.6完善“公司客户管理系统”,打开“公司客户管理系统”数据库,右键点击“客户信息管理”,选择“设计视图”命令,1、 2,选择“添加”按钮,点击“编码”按钮。打开代码编辑窗口,为“添加”按钮的点击事件编写代码(命令39),该代码实现添加新客户数据的功能,4、在对象列表中选择“命令39”,在事件流程列表中选择“点击”事件,3、为“查询”按钮的点击事件编写代码(命令57),6、在对象列表中选择“命令57”,在事件流程列表中选择“点击”事件,5、为清除所有客户信息的点击事件(注意)”按钮(命令58)编写以下代码。8.在对象列表中选择“命令58”,在事件进程列表中选择“点击”事件。7.为“保存修改”按钮的点击事件(命令90)编写以下代码。该代码实现了数据保存的功能。10.在对象列表中选择“命令90”,在事件进程列表中选择“点击”事件,9,为“保存修改”按钮(命令91)的点击事件编写以下代码,12,在对象列表中选择“命令91”,在事件进程列表中选择“点击”事件,11,这是查询数据的实现效果,9.2购销存管理系统,9.2.1系统数据库和表格设计。作为一个销售公司或一个工厂的销售部门,建立一个完善的“购销存管理系统”是控制商品采购和监控企业利润的关键。下面将以示例的形式描述“购买、销售和存储管理系统”的创建。在本例中,“购销存管理系统”由四个表组成:“产品类型”表、“产品信息”表、“出库数据”表和“入库数据”表,如下页所示。表的创建已经在几个地方描述过了,这里不再详细解释。对于标有“查找向导”的表中的字段类型,请使用查找向导来关联相关表中的相关字段。9.2.2要创建一个查询,我们需要创建三个查询,如图所示。在这三个查询中,“入站数据查询”基于“入站数据”表,“出站数据查询”基于“出站数据”表。将显示除“标识”字段之外的所有字段。“利润查询”基于“产品信息”,仅显示“类别标识”和“产品名称”字段。使用“查询向导”可以轻松创建这三个查询。这里将不详细描述创建方法。9.2.3建立主要表格。该系统仅由一种形式组成。左侧有一个用于“出站”和“入站”的单选按钮。选择“出站”和“入站”单选按钮。底部和右侧的数据会相应改变。单击“选项组”按钮,并使用向导在表单上添加带有两个选项按钮的选项组控件。2.打开库存管理系统数据库,打开表单的设计视图。1.添加一个名为“产品名称”的下拉按钮控件,并在“产品信息”表中与产品名称相关。添加另外五个文本框和两个命令按钮。3,分别右键单击“产品名称”、“产品价格”、“收货日期”和“收货数量”四个文本框,在弹出菜单中选择“属性”命令,打开“属性”设置窗口,将“产品名称”、“产品价格”和“收货数量”控件的默认值设置为0,将有效性规则的默认值设置为“将“入库日期”的默认值设置为“=日期()”(即默认值为当前的“=日期()”,有效性规则为“,4,5.通过属性设置,使这两个窗体完全重合,分别命名窗体出站数据查询和入站数据查询,分别命名它们的标签出站数据和入站数据, 9、点击子窗体/子报表按钮。使用向导在表单上添加两个子表单,将“入站数据查询”和“出站数据查询”作为数据源。8.关闭主窗体的设计视图,并将其保存为“主窗体”。10,右键单击“产品编号”等控件,选择“属性”命令,打开其“属性”窗口。12.右键单击“出站数据查询”表单,选择“设计视图”命令打开其设计视图。11、 14,选择“可用”属性为“否”,选择“锁定”属性为“是”(所有五个白色控件具有相同的设置),13,单击左上角的表单属性按钮打开表单的属性对话框,只留下“数据表”视图为“是”,“允许编辑”属性为“否”,“允许删除”属性为“是”,“允许添加”属性为“否”,“数据输入”属性为“否”,完成此表单的设置后,双击左上角的“属性”按钮,打开“主窗体”的设计视图并打开其属性设置窗口。将“主窗体”的属性设置为:标题为“采购、销售和存储管理系统”;仅允许表单视图;记录选择器为否导航按钮”为“否”,边框样式为“细边框”;“最大化和最小化按钮”是“无”。然后保存窗口设置,完成主窗体的创建。15,16,9.2.4在主表单中添加代码。在主窗体的设计界面,点击代码按钮,打开购销存管理系统数据库的代码设置窗口。在此窗口中,您可以通过“控制选择”下拉列表和“功能选择”下拉列表为不同的控制选择不同的操作设计代码。因为添加代码的过程是用幻灯片演示的,所以它没有多大的实际意义。建议学生在课文中反复学习本文提供的代码,以理解每个代码的含义。只有这样,他们才能从其他例子中得出结论,并为自己创建更好的数据库打下良好的基础。这个课件没有太多关于添加代码的内容。9.2.5建立“利润查询”报告并添加代码。我们主要统计每个产品的“采购数量”、“采购总额”、“发货总额”和“发货总额”,根据“销售商品”计算基本利润状况,然后根据“采购总额”和“发货总额”比较当前的资金占用情况。在此报表中增加如下图所示的字段:采购总额、采购额、发货总额、发货额、发货利润、资金损失,并删除附带的标签。2.使用向导创建利润查询报表,使用利润查询查询作为数据源。请注意,利润查询报告只有前两个字段:“类别标识”和“产品名称”。右键单击
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 项目出资合同协议书范本
- 物流公司的采购合同范本
- 门面房车位出租合同范本
- 消防施工协议合同书范本
- 汉中酒店承包联营协议书
- 电商app开发合同范本
- 申请延期的补充合同范本
- 派出所门面出租合同范本
- 父子结婚房子协议书范本
- 污泥处理外包合同协议书
- 四川绵阳公开招聘社区工作者考试高频题库带答案2025年
- 恋爱协议书范文模板
- 2025工程建设项目多测合一成果报告书范本
- 2025-2030年中国热力生产和供应行业竞争状况规划研究报告
- 2025年四川酒业茶业集团投资有限公司及下属子公司招聘笔试参考题库附带答案详解
- 珊瑚礁生态修复施工方案
- 四川省成都市2024-2025学年高一上学期期末考试历史试题(含答案)
- 我的家乡泉州
- 体外冲击波碎石
- AEO贸易安全培训
- 科研办公楼建筑设计与规划方案
评论
0/150
提交评论